GENERAL  M. B. STEWART

AP   140

 

BUILT:  1945  BEAM:  71'-6"  DRAFT:  24' 
LENGTH:  522'-10"   CARGO [cu ft]:  32,800   PASS [troop ship]:  3,130  
PROPULSION: Turbine   RADIUS [miles]: 15,000 TONS:  13,000
TYPE:   C4 SPEED [knots]:  17 DEPENDENTS / JAPAN: Yes

Named in honor of Maj Gen Merch Bradt Stewart, USMA Class 1896, Spanish-Am War, WW I. 

Decommissioned May 1946 and turned over to WSA for duty in the Army Transport Service until reacquired by the Navy in 1950 for MSTS.

Sold 1967, renamed Merchant Albany.
